HVAC rep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ues with he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ems to ensure they operate efficiently and reliably. These services typically include troubleshooting problems such as inconsistent temperatures, strange noises, or system failures. Technicians may repair or replace components like thermostats, compressors, fans, or ductwork to restore proper function. Regular maintenance and prompt repairs can help prevent more costly breakdowns and extend the lifespan of HVAC equipment.
Common problems addressed by HVAC repair services include system breakdowns during extreme weather, poor airflow, refrigerant leaks, or thermostat malfunctions. Homeowners often seek repairs when their heating or cooling systems stop working altogether, cycle frequently, or fail to maintain a comfortable indoor environment. Addressing these issues quickly can improve indoor air quality, reduce energy bills, and create a more comfortable living space. Skilled service providers can identify the root causes of these problems and recommend effective solutions.

The overview below groups typical Hvac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for common repairs like fixing a thermostat or replacing a fan motor range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the specific part or issue involved. Fewer projects tend to push into the higher end of this band.
Air Conditioner Tune-Ups - Regular maintenance services usually cost between $100 and $300. Most homeowners find their service providers charge within this range for standard tune-ups, with more extensive inspections reaching higher prices.
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ire HVAC system can range from $4,000 to $12,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the installation.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, but many replacements fall into the middle tiers.
Emergency Repairs - Urgent repairs, such as fixing a broken heater during a cold snap, typically cost between $300 and $1,000. These projects often fall into the higher end of the typical range due to the urgency and potential additional labor cost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
